Output 3dd291a1ec00f279b15e961a4096b74344c7e05ff8ffc72fb2e53954d87b5526:10

value
63107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e166e9d0d592221f2beb839a59e275fd51d876 OP_EQUAL
address
37hMsDdg3u8wFvHSz7KTaZb9TjsFr7XoRP
transaction
3dd291a1ec00f279b15e961a4096b74344c7e05ff8ffc72fb2e53954d87b5526
spent
true